MDY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

856 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R S&P MIDCAP 400 ETF Trust (MDY)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$11B — up 1.1% from $10.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 51 funds opened new MDY posit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 237 added to existing stakes and 361 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BNP Paribas Financial Markets, adding an estimated $88.8M. The largest seller was Freedom Investment Management, cutting an estimated $114M.
